💰 Cost Comparison (Real 2026 Data)
- Hotels are cheaper in 46 out of 50 major cities when all Airbnb fees are included
- Airbnb fees (cleaning + taxes) can increase price by ~40%
- Hotels win:
- 1–3 nights → cheaper most of the time
- Airbnb wins:
- 5–7+ nights → cheaper in ~70% cases
👉 Key takeaway:
Hotels dominate short stays, Airbnb becomes cheaper over longer stays.
🏠 Airbnb: Pros & Cons
✅ Advantages
- More space (entire home, multiple rooms)
- Ideal for families & groups
- Kitchen helps save food costs
- Local, home-like experience
❌ Disadvantages
- Hidden fees (cleaning, taxes)
- No daily housekeeping
- Quality depends on host
- Possible cancellations/issues
🏨 Hotels: Pros & Cons
✅ Advantages
- Consistent quality and cleanliness
- 24/7 customer service
- Amenities (gym, pool, breakfast)
- Loyalty rewards (Hilton, Marriott, etc.)
❌ Disadvantages
- Smaller rooms
- Expensive for large groups
- Less privacy
- No kitchen
📊 2026 Travel Trends
- 53% of travelers still prefer hotels despite Airbnb growth
- Airbnb listings exceed 8 million globally, offering huge variety
- Hotels are adapting by offering apartment-style rooms with kitchens
👉 This means competition is stronger than ever in 2026.
